John Woo confirmed to direct 1949

In keeping with his current trend of war period pieces, John Woo announced at Cannes that he will direct and produce 1949, a romance set at the end of World War II. Woo will begin work on the project after he completes the epic Red Cliff, which is based on Chinese lore set in the Han era.

The Chinese-language film is slated to release in December 2009, which marks 60 years since the onset of the People’s Republic of China. Wong Hui-Ling who also penned Lust, Caution, wrote the script. Ling I-Jun and China Film Group will be financing the project and Fortissimo Films will be handling distribution. Lion Rock’s Terence Chang will also be involved in production.

Woo will begin filming this December in Taiwan and China. Chang Chen and Korea's Song Hye-kyo are set to star. The story is intended to shed light on “the realities of the history of the Chinese people and nation,” Fortissimo co-chief Michael J. Werner told Variety.
